Ar Tonelico II: Melody of Metafalica Review

Posted in Uncategorized with tags , , , , , , on February 26, 2009 by mancalledd

  I missed the memo we are having a contest to see who can release the last PS2 game I guess. Nis (Nippon Ichi Software) tries to win the race with Ar Tonelico, while Atlus will be releasing Shin Megami Tensei: Devil Summoner: Raidou Kazahou vs. King Abadon in MAY. Freakin’ May. I mean, isn’t this getting a wee bit intense?

   Anywho, SMT: Persona 4 will easily remain the undisputed swan song for probably the greatest console of all time, however, Ar Tonelico does a damn fine job of trying to upset that. 

    This is a sequel, but no knowledge of the previous game is required to enjoy this iteration. The story here is top notch, with many different tangents to go off on. For instance, there comes a point ten hours in where you can decide to defend the current regime during war or join the rebels. Yes, you really get to make that dramatic of a choice. The battle system here also pulls out all the stunts like your drunk uncle at a Christmas party trying to impress your teenage girlfriend. The battles are based on- oh you don’t give a rip. Lemme break it down- 2 knights in front on offense, 2 hot chicks in the back spellcastin’.  Sounds rudimentary (it is turn-based like a Final Fantasy), BUT during the enemy’s offense, you get to actively defend in a very intense sequence. It may sound lame, but it is a HUGE advancement in the field of RPGs. 

     And then there’s the story. The game basically gives you a main quest, bujt you can do so much else; everything from crafting your own weapons, starting fan clubs for the wizards in your group, go dungeon crawling, and even choose who  to date and develop relationships with. It truly overdoes the customization and expansion part.

     But, hey, there are flaws. The biggest? The sexual references. I am not kidding when I say it is like this game is a fat person who has just ate a friggin’ bucket of beans and is farting out sexual innuendo. I cannot even get you to fathom a miniscule amount of how cheesey this is. There is also very little voiceover work. The graphics also look like every game designer who made RPGs on the PS1 got together and made a fan sequel. (The eyes of Croix…..literally look like a) A giant ceespool or b) A black hole.) Also, I have caught wind by other reviews of a bug that will wipe your entire save literally about an hour before the game’s close. 

     I doubt many people will take this game seriously, which is a shame. It will most likely live in SMT: P4’s shadow forever. And to be honest, SMT: RKVKA will probably be on par with this come May. At least in terms of gameplay, but there is something about this game that sticks with you. Highly recommended at the budget price of $40. Also, EVERY package of this game comes with an art booklet and full soundtrack CD.
